Transaction 2531720b87fa2a5aa2b307b260a3ae202440b7fde5a0eebf3514ae94a05aa968

1 Input
2 Outputs
  • 2531720b87fa2a5aa2b307b260a3ae202440b7fde5a0eebf3514ae94a05aa968:0
  • value  5288878
    address  1E6XhufUBqm4ds73eb1mMpFmDXytW34SGp
  • 2531720b87fa2a5aa2b307b260a3ae202440b7fde5a0eebf3514ae94a05aa968:1
  • value  350308045
    address  1BvS5vPYS4oic5iwCG5AH4AwfggW7yxSK